The controller should hold replica count steady at
// 6 rather than flapping, because the smoothing window (90s EWMA)
// absorbs the oscillation. If this test fails, check the cooldown
// constant before touching the EWMA alpha — they interact badly.
//
// The fixture replays recorded metrics from the staging collector,
// which requires authenticating with the token below.
// -----------------------------------------------------------------

login token, bagug-kafop: eyJhbGciOiJIUzI1NiIsInR5cCI6IkpXVCJ9.eyJzdWIiOiIcMLov2In0.Z5RLDIfp

Filed by: Front desk, Quillhaven branch of Merrowbank Retail

The scheduled Tuesday cash-box collection by Stonegate Secure Couriers did not occur. The driver reportedly arrived at the old loading dock on Harrow Lane, which closed last month, and left without checking the new entrance. The cash box remains sealed in the branch safe, logged and double-counted by two staff per procedure. A replacement run is booked for Thursday morning. For the records team, the confidential hand-over instruction for the rescheduled run is noted below.

courier memo of yahif-faweg: the quenael tamius courier leaves the prawyn jorix kaswyn istox silmir brieth zormir fenvan ledger at gate 3145 under passcode 231062

## Releases

Deep-link routing tables for the Wrenpath mobile app are versioned and shipped alongside each release. Reviewers should confirm that every new route has a corresponding fallback web path and that the universal-link manifest was regenerated. Tags follow `routing-vX.Y` and are built reproducibly. Each routing bundle is signed prior to publication with the key below.

release key, yahif-kajeg: bky19_YSG492TE1CUe938KkHv